GVI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

279 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Intermediate Government/Credit Bond ETF (GVI)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$2.94B — up 0.44% from $2.93B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 30 funds opened new GVI positions and 20 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 106 added to existing stakes and 95 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Eastern Bank, adding an estimated $55.6M. The largest seller was Financial Counselors Inc, exiting entirely with an estimated $104M sold.
